Accident Summary Nr: 94709.015 - Employee sustains second degree burns when propane ignites

Abstract: At 11:00 a.m. on April 10, 2017, Employee #1 was fueling a forklift cylinder with propane. The nozzle valve was bumped open when the nozzle reel retracted the fuel hose. When the employee noticed that the valve was open, he went to shut it off. The employee was wearing personal protective equipment, but had removed it when the fueling was complete. The gas cloud ignited upon touch, and Employee #1 sustained second degree burns to his arms, neck and face. Employee #1 was hospitalized for treatment.
